Explanation:
Albert Bandura was a social psychologist who worked on observational learning behavior. He discussed how children's behavior can be influenced by observation. The children who watched the aggressive movie act in an aggressive manner. The learning that occurs through watching and imitating and does not influence my personal experiences are called social learning. Thus if children watch or imitate non-violent behavior or action they behave in a non-destructing way.
Thus modeling and imitation are the way through which children can learn a behavior whether it is violent or non-violent.
